mesa/src
Francisco Jerez c1feccdd90 intel/fs/gfx20+: Fix surface state address on extended descriptors for NIR scratch intrinsics.
The r0.5 thread payload register contains Surface State Offset bits
[27:6] as bits [31:10], so we need to shift the register right by 4 in
order to get the surface state offset expected in ExBSO mode, which is
the only extended descriptor encoding supported by the UGM shared
function for SS addressing on Xe2+.

Reviewed-by: Lionel Landwerlin <lionel.g.landwerlin@intel.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/29543>
2024-06-21 01:49:43 +00:00
..
amd ac/llvm: implement WA in nir to llvm 2024-06-20 13:14:33 +00:00
android_stub vulkan/android: Add helper to probe AHB support 2024-05-14 14:53:44 +00:00
asahi treewide: use nir_metadata_control_flow 2024-06-17 16:28:14 -04:00
broadcom v3dv: don't call wsi_device_init too early 2024-06-20 10:21:26 +00:00
c11
compiler clc: remove check for null pointer that cannot be true in llvm_mod_to_spirv 2024-06-21 00:41:28 +00:00
drm-shim drm-shim: Stub syncobj reset ioctl 2024-05-21 14:14:25 +00:00
egl egl/dri2: add support for EGL_EXT_surface_compression 2024-06-12 21:20:06 +00:00
etnaviv etnaviv: update headers from rnndb 2024-06-12 16:34:30 +00:00
freedreno freedreno/devices: Fix magic regs for Adreno A32 2024-06-20 17:55:57 +00:00
gallium iris/xe2+: Fix format of scratch space surface address in various 3DSTATE packets. 2024-06-21 01:49:43 +00:00
gbm gbm: Support fixed-rate compression allocation 2024-06-12 21:20:06 +00:00
getopt
glx glx: fix build -D glx-direct=false 2024-06-14 16:24:33 +00:00
gtest
imagination pvr: use common stype debug 2024-05-10 18:49:38 +00:00
imgui
intel intel/fs/gfx20+: Fix surface state address on extended descriptors for NIR scratch intrinsics. 2024-06-21 01:49:43 +00:00
loader loader: silence implicit-load zink error by the loader 2024-05-10 14:19:59 +00:00
mapi mapi: add EXT_texture_storage_compression extension 2024-06-12 21:20:06 +00:00
mesa glsl: make glsl_to_nir() more generic 2024-06-20 00:56:10 +00:00
microsoft treewide: use nir_metadata_control_flow 2024-06-17 16:28:14 -04:00
nouveau nak: Move nak_optimize_nir declaration to nak_private.h 2024-06-19 20:39:30 +00:00
panfrost panvk: Enable offscreen_viewport tests in CI for Mali-G52 2024-06-20 14:27:02 +00:00
tool pps: Config tweaks to avoid loosing traces 2024-03-25 19:49:50 +00:00
util u_gralloc/fallback: Set fd from handle directly 2024-06-20 05:57:06 +00:00
virtio venus/ci: skip timed out test 2024-06-20 19:39:02 +00:00
vulkan vulkan: handle enqueueing CmdPushDescriptorSet2KHR 2024-06-20 16:43:56 +00:00
.clang-format asahi: add agx_ppp_push_merged helper 2024-05-14 04:57:27 +00:00
meson.build loader/wayland: Add fallback wl_display_dispatch_queue_timeout 2024-02-27 13:10:13 +00:00